WebNov 8, 2024 · Abdominals can relax after core work if they are fatigued. Pelvis and spinal positioning can literally push the belly out. A tight psoas muscle can act as a pulling force, causing abdominal bulging. As can diastasis recti, a rectus-dominant abdominal strategy, weak lateral abdominals, and more. Exhale as you come up and keep your … growth chart 0-24 monthsWebMay 25, 2024 · The main difference between sit-ups and crunches is the range of motion involved in each exercise. Sit-ups require you to lift all the way up, while crunches require a slight lift off the ground. Sit-ups can activate more muscles than crunches, but they may also present a greater injury risk.
